Five Americans killed in Peru chopper crash
Peru (AP) — Five US citizens are among seven people killed in the crash of a US-owned cargo helicopter in the Peruvian jungle.
Peruvian authorities say the heavy-lift chopper crashed yesterday, after taking off from the provincial capital of Pucallpa.
It was owned by Columbia Helicopters of Portland, Oregon.
The company's executive vice president, Peter Lance, confirms the deaths.
He told The Associated Press the five dead Americans were employees of the company.
Lance did not immediately provide more information.
Local police official Miguel Cardoso said this morning that three bodies have been so far been recovered.
He said it appears all jumped from the chopper.
